Lovehoney Launches Retailer Product Display Competition

CYBERSPACE — Lovehoney is touting a competition for retailers to promote its Happy Rabbit range of products.

Brick-and-mortar retailers are encouraged to "get creative and design their own unique window or in-store display,” a rep said. “The window display must feature at least 12 units of any of the Happy Rabbits. Good luck!”

The competition runs Friday through March 8; a winner will be chosen on March 12. The first-place winner will receive an Apple 32gb iPad. The runner-up prize is the Beats Pill+ portable speaker and the third-place prize is a Fitbit Alta fitness wristband.

Entrants should email a picture of their window or in-store display, along with their name, email address, store name and street address to trade@lovehoney.co.uk.

Certain terms and conditions apply to the competition. Direct questions to tradeenquiries@lovehoney.co.uk.
